Internal Memo — Board, Quellbrook Systems

Re: Q3 cash-flow forecast. Operating inflows tracking 6% under plan; collections slowed in the Harlow Ridge region. Outflows held flat. Net position remains positive but the buffer narrows to five weeks by quarter-end. Treasury will defer two capital purchases and accelerate invoicing on the Mirelle contract. No covenant risk at present. Weekly monitoring continues until recovery is confirmed. Strategic implications for next quarter are noted confidentially below.

board note of baguf-fafog: Kasixox Foods plans to lower the Drueth list price by 48 percent in March.

**Q: What happens to my plugin hooks during a blue-green deploy of the Tallygrove billing worker?** Both colors run your hooks simultaneously for up to ten minutes; idempotency keys prevent double charges, but long-running callbacks may be retried on the incoming color. Do not cache worker-instance state across invocations. If a cutover strands your plugin mid-transaction, open a recovery ticket and confirm ownership with the passphrase printed directly below this answer.

vault phrase of yagag-kadup = belael-druius-rusax-kelox

# Limits & Quotas: WebSocket Reconnect (Tallowgate Gateway)

Context for new folks: a reconnect bug in the Tallowgate gateway caused clients to retry in tight loops, tripping per-IP quotas fleet-wide. Fix shipped in v4.2; limits were retuned afterward. Reconnects now use capped exponential backoff with jitter. Exceeding the cap returns a throttle frame, not a disconnect. Do not change these without a load test. Current enforced limits are:

tuning table, yajog-yahof:
BUDGETS = {
    "lamvan": 303,
    "wenox": 460,
    "fenvan": 525,
}